5 years wiser, I found my way back to audi
Hi all, my name is Nick, born and raised in southern Maine. I just wanted to introduce myself and give you guys a little bit about me and show off some pics of my new car.
When I was 19 years old, I bought my first Audi. It was a 2001 C5 A6 that I paid way too much for, but I loved it. It was a 2.8 automatic that needed tons of work, but I fell in love with the comforts inside, the smooth ride and let's face it, who doesn't like turning heads?
Here I am, 24 and a lot more car smart and I've been yearning for the chance to get into another audi, but I didn't want to repeat the mistakes I did in my first purchase, so I've been patient. When I had my a6, I was sort of jealous of it's smaller cousin, the a4, so I was leaning in that direction. I went through tons of craigslist adds, looked at more cars than I care to talk about, and I was starting to lose hope, maybe it wasn't meant to be. A couple of friends and I went to look at a few a4s one night, but when we got to the dealer who had them, they had closed for the night. Frustrated that we had driven over an hour, we cruised through a few dealerships on the way home looking through the used cars, with no luck. That's when my good friend Paul called a local dealer we both knew from local the local car scene. As Paul talks to him, I roll my eyes thinking there's no way he has an a4. "I bought one today" I hear from the phone.
So we drive another hour to his shop, and instantly I liked the look of the car. The body was really clean with only a few minor dings, and after a test drive I fell in love. After looking it over on the lift and admiring how clean it was, I sealed the deal. 2007 B7 A4, mechanically sound, everything is nice and tight suspension wise, no check engine lights and the interior is 9.5-10. Needless to say I'm excited, I go pick her up today


2.0T 6 speed manual with a front mount, CAI, diverter valve and she's lowered on neuspeed suspension. Here's some pics... Oh and the best part? I paid $4250
